I am currently interested in purchasing a 250-300cc off road kart or buggy for our kids to run on our relativly hilly property,however I would like it to be large enough ( leg room ) for my wife and I to take it for an occasional ride ( two seater ). I am very interested in the BMS Power Buggy 250 or the Roketta GK-06A, but everything I have read on Roketta or Sunl says to stay away from their karts. The other dilema I have is that the BMS Power Buggy 250 looks suspicously like a dressed up Roketta GK-06. If anyone could shed some light on this subject it would be greatly appreciated.
SUNL and Roketa are junk dealers that provide little to no post sale support or replacement parts. Can't really tell ya anything about BMS as I have had no experience with em.
I'd wait another month or two and check out the Kinroad 300cc phoenix.
I believe the BMS is just a glorified Roketa.My local dealer sells them and says the parts supply is good if you have a local dealer to get them for you.I was worried about this and ended up buying 2 Hammerhead HH250SS.The parts are very easy to get and they will climb any hill they can get traction on.You may also want to check out the Joyner 250.They both have a high and low gear that is great.I am 6 foot 275lb and drive my HH250SS a lot.One other thing about the BMS is that it does not have the locked rear end and may not climb hills all that well.I also was told that the BMS is quite a bit slower due to the extra weight.I do know that the BMS is a lot larger and has more room in it.I am not knocking the BMS but it just was not the buggy for me.Maybe someone that has the BMS will chime in and let you know about reliability and parts supply.I can only tell you what the dealer told me.
